Output d85a2e8b43a7d35f359792f887aef1eaeaba2fc034e13aad2de10d6a31bc4e13:0

value
25828400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ab107dfaf88c5e2b51ca8b7a0b19b0e1a7105133 OP_EQUAL
address
3HHXEEoEvGDukmFwYbfHTh9zJmF9ZVs48i
transaction
d85a2e8b43a7d35f359792f887aef1eaeaba2fc034e13aad2de10d6a31bc4e13
spent
true